Verizon Offers Quick Information With Its ScanLife Mobile Barcode Application

Verizon has just announced that it is offering a free barcode scanner application to its subscribers, giving them easy access to information. Currently over 30 devices are supported, and you’ll be able to point your mobile phone’s browser to the site and see if your phone is supported. The app allows users to scan the barcode on items and view useful information such as product details, user reviews, request coupon offers from magazines, launch audio tours from kiosks and other useful features. Considering it’s free, it’s quite a nifty feature.
